A really grumpy old man writes:
Giovanni seems to think that the difference between a back-page puzzle and a Toughie is to throw in some words that are in the vocabulary of just a handful of people. That may well be fine in a barred puzzle where the solver expects to be using a dictionary most of the time, but in a puzzle that should be capable of being solved by the man on a Clapham Omnibus while he is on that vehicle it just doesn’t work.
